NAB show is the launch pad for the RCS LaunchPad
Written on March 27, 2015 at 10:15, by Fergal Ringrose, Editorial Director, Europe
Reality Check Systems (RCS) will spotlight the newest iteration of LaunchPad, its production-proven interactive touchscreen solution that simplifies advanced soccer analysis for live broadcasts. The release will be on display at the Vizrt booth and includes new features designed to empower storytelling, boost fan engagement and expand compatibility with industry-standard tools.
